当前位置: 首页 > news >正文

免费SQLite浏览器终极指南:浏览器中直接管理数据库的完整解决方案

免费SQLite浏览器终极指南:浏览器中直接管理数据库的完整解决方案

【免费下载链接】sqlite-viewerView SQLite file online项目地址: https://gitcode.com/gh_mirrors/sq/sqlite-viewer

在数据无处不在的今天,SQLite作为轻量级数据库已经成为移动应用、Web项目和桌面软件的首选。但传统的SQLite查看工具往往需要繁琐的安装配置,让许多用户望而却步。现在,SQLite Viewer这款免费开源工具彻底改变了这一现状,让你无需安装任何软件,直接在浏览器中就能查看和管理SQLite数据库文件。

🌟 为什么你需要一个浏览器端的SQLite查看器?

想象一下这样的场景:你正在开发一个Android应用,需要快速查看SQLite数据库的内容来调试数据问题。传统的方式需要将数据库文件导出到电脑,再用专门的工具打开——这个过程既耗时又麻烦。

或者你是一个正在学习SQL的学生,想要实践数据库查询操作,但不想配置复杂的数据库环境。又或者,你只是需要快速浏览一个小型SQLite文件的结构和数据。

SQLite Viewer就是为了解决这些痛点而生。它基于先进的sql.js技术,所有数据处理都在客户端浏览器中完成,这意味着你的敏感数据永远不会离开你的设备,安全性和隐私保护得到充分保障。

SQLite Viewer直观的用户界面,左侧显示表结构,右侧展示查询结果

🚀 三分钟快速上手:从零开始使用SQLite Viewer

在线即时体验

最简单的方式是直接访问项目提供的在线页面。这种方式适合临时查看或快速验证数据库内容,真正做到"开箱即用"。

本地部署方案

如果你需要在没有网络的环境下工作,或者希望自定义功能,可以通过以下命令将项目部署到本地:

git clone https://gitcode.com/gh_mirrors/sq/sqlite-viewer cd sqlite-viewer

然后用浏览器打开index.html文件即可享受完整的SQLite查看功能。这个本地部署方案特别适合开发人员在本地环境中进行数据库调试。

内置示例数据库

项目内置了Chinook示例数据库,位于examples/Chinook_Sqlite.sqlite。你可以直接加载这个文件来熟悉工具的各项功能。这个示例数据库包含了音乐相关的数据表,非常适合用来练习SQL查询。

🔧 核心功能深度解析

直观的表结构浏览

打开一个SQLite文件后,左侧面板会清晰展示数据库中的所有表名和行数统计。你可以快速了解数据的整体架构,轻松导航到感兴趣的数据表。

灵活的SQL查询编辑器

内置的SQL编辑器支持语法高亮,让你编写复杂的查询语句时更加得心应手。编辑器会自动补全SQL关键字,减少输入错误。

实时查询执行与结果展示

输入SQL语句后,点击蓝色的"Execute"按钮,查询结果会立即以表格形式展示在下方。表格支持排序、筛选和滚动浏览,处理大量数据时依然保持流畅。

数据导出功能

查询结果可以导出为多种格式,方便后续的数据分析和报告制作。无论你需要CSV格式进行数据分析,还是需要JSON格式进行API对接,SQLite Viewer都能满足你的需求。

💡 实用技巧与最佳实践

移动应用开发调试

对于Android或iOS开发者来说,SQLite Viewer是一个宝贵的调试工具。你可以直接将应用生成的SQLite数据库文件拖入浏览器中查看,无需复杂的导出和转换过程。

教育与学习辅助

对于正在学习SQL和数据库原理的学生,SQLite Viewer提供了完美的实践平台。配合内置的示例数据库,你可以练习各种SQL语句,从简单的SELECT查询到复杂的JOIN操作。

数据分析预处理

处理小规模数据集时,启动庞大的数据库管理系统显得过于笨重。SQLite Viewer让你快速浏览数据结构、验证数据格式,为后续的深入分析做好充分准备。

🛡️ 安全性与隐私保护

本地数据处理

SQLite Viewer的所有数据库解析和操作都在你的浏览器沙箱环境中完成。这意味着:

  • 敏感数据不会上传到任何服务器
  • 商业机密和个人信息得到最大程度的保护
  • 即使在没有网络的环境下也能正常工作

开源透明

项目遵循Apache 2.0开源协议,代码完全透明可审计。你可以自由查看、修改甚至进行二次开发,确保没有隐藏的后门或安全漏洞。

📊 技术优势与性能表现

跨平台兼容性

SQLite Viewer支持所有现代浏览器,包括Chrome、Firefox、Safari和Edge。无论你使用Windows、macOS、Linux还是移动设备,都能获得一致的体验。

内存优化处理

虽然浏览器有内存限制,但SQLite Viewer通过智能的数据分页和懒加载技术,能够高效处理中等大小的数据库文件。建议处理的SQLite文件大小不超过100MB以获得最佳体验。

文件格式兼容

支持各种主流的SQLite文件格式,无论是简单的数据表还是复杂的关联查询,都能完美呈现。无需担心版本兼容性问题。

🔄 高级用法与扩展功能

远程文件加载

通过URL参数直接加载远程服务器上的SQLite文件,使用格式如下:

http://你的部署地址/?url=远程文件地址

这种方式适合需要频繁访问固定网络数据库的场景,避免了重复上传文件的繁琐操作。需要注意的是,远程服务器需要正确配置CORS策略。

自定义界面主题

通过修改CSS文件,你可以自定义SQLite Viewer的界面主题,使其更符合你的品牌风格或个人偏好。

扩展功能开发

由于项目完全开源,你可以基于现有代码开发新的功能模块。比如添加数据可视化图表、导出为更多格式、或者集成其他数据库管理功能。

⚠️ 使用注意事项与限制

  • 由于浏览器内存限制,建议处理的SQLite文件大小不超过100MB
  • 对于复杂的数据库管理需求,建议配合专业的数据库工具使用
  • 远程文件加载需要服务器正确配置CORS策略
  • 某些高级SQLite特性可能不受支持,建议先测试确认

🎯 总结:重新定义SQLite数据管理体验

SQLite Viewer以其简洁的设计、实用的功能和高度的安全性,为SQLite数据库查看提供了全新的解决方案。无论你是需要快速查看数据库内容的开发者,还是学习SQL的学生,这款工具都能满足你的需求。

它的零安装特性、本地处理模式和开源免费的优势,使其成为日常工作中处理SQLite数据库的理想选择。立即体验SQLite Viewer,感受浏览器端数据库管理的便捷与高效!

通过本文的介绍,你已经了解了SQLite Viewer的核心功能和使用技巧。现在就开始使用这款强大的工具,让你的SQLite数据库管理工作变得更加简单高效吧!

【免费下载链接】sqlite-viewerView SQLite file online项目地址: https://gitcode.com/gh_mirrors/sq/sqlite-viewer

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/627819/

相关文章:

  • Display Driver Uninstaller深度解析:为什么这是显卡驱动清理的终极解决方案?
  • 2026年AI优化公司哪家靠谱?行业选择要点解析 - 品牌排行榜
  • 手把手教你用IndexTTS 2.0:从安装到生成第一段语音,超详细教程
  • 2026警用电动车供应商行业现状及应用场景分析 - 品牌排行榜
  • 向后兼容的工程伦理:Python 开发中“优雅重构”与“责任担当”的平衡之道
  • Phi-3-Mini-128K开源大模型部署教程:适配A10/A100/L4等企业级GPU集群
  • RexUniNLU模型部署避坑指南:常见错误及解决方法
  • STM32串口Bootloader实战:基于Ymodem协议与STM32F303RCT6的移植与优化
  • 全任务零样本学习-mT5中文-baseAPI教程:POST /augment_batch批量处理最佳实践
  • 如何突破网易云音乐格式限制?三分钟掌握NCM文件解密技巧
  • LOWPOWER微源 LP3100QVF TDFN-12 电荷泵
  • 告别显存焦虑!FLUX.1-dev旗舰版保姆级部署,小白也能画高清壁纸
  • 聊聊2026年专业的AI GEO推广机构,山东地区靠谱的有哪些 - 工业品牌热点
  • 终极性能调校:Universal x86 Tuning Utility如何释放你的硬件潜能
  • 如何用OneMore插件实现高效笔记管理:5个实用技巧提升OneNote生产力
  • translategemma-4b-it实战案例:为盲文识别APP集成Ollama图文翻译模块
  • OneAPI开源网关应用:SaaS厂商集成通义千问+混元双模型方案
  • Python 技术方案权衡之道:平衡性能、复杂度、团队认知、交付周期与长期维护的实战指南
  • AI Agent设计核心:用Phi-4-mini-reasoning构建具备推理能力的智能体
  • STK与MATLAB交互:Astrogator模块数据自动化处理实战
  • Python 故障复盘之道:让线上事故真正转化为团队能力的实战指南
  • 5分钟快速指南:如何用DOL汉化美化整合包打造个性化游戏体验
  • Z-Image-Turbo-rinaiqiao-huiyewunv快速上手:Jetson Orin Nano边缘设备部署可行性验证
  • 实体、关系、属性:知识图谱三大基本要素详解
  • Qwen2.5-VL-7B-Instruct保姆级教程:RTX 4090专属,5分钟搞定图文对话AI助手
  • 忍者像素绘卷:天界画坊Java八股文精讲:从理论到AI工程实践
  • CoPaw模型提示词(Prompt)工程高级教程:从基础到精通
  • ComfyUI-Manager终极指南:掌握AI工作流节点管理的完整解决方案
  • 盘点2026年管家婆软件排名,哪家服务西北区域更值得选 - 工业品网
  • 实时手机检测-通用GPU算力适配教程:RTX3060/4090/A10实测配置推荐